Huge aortic arch aneurysm presenting with subacute cough: a case report.

Indian J Thorac Cardiovasc Surg

August 2025

Department of Cardiovascular Surgery, Shingu Municipal Medical Center, Shingu, Wakayama Japan.

A 74-year-old Asian female patient with a history of hypertension and dyslipidemia presented with a subacute dry cough of one month duration. Chest radiography revealed mediastinal enlargement and contrast-enhanced computed tomography revealed a huge saccular aortic arch aneurysm compressing the left lung and protruding to the anterior chest wall. Open surgical intervention using a frozen elephant trunk was successfully performed to treat the aortic aneurysm, and the cough improved completely with aneurysm sac shrinkage six months postoperatively.

How can China protect 30% of its land?

Trends Ecol Evol

September 2025

Royal Botanic Garden Edinburgh, Inverleith Row, Edinburgh EH3 5LR, UK.

The Kunming-Montreal Global Biodiversity Framework aims to conserve 30% of land globally by 2030 using protected areas (PAs) and 'other effective area-based conservation measures' (OECMs). China plans to expand PAs to 18% of the land area. An additional 12% can be designated as OECMs within the ecological protection red lines.
